Comments: I had the pleasure of picking up the Davenport in East Liverpool after Union Boiler bought her from the bank after a repo. She had Cooper Besmers then and sounded sweet. We repowered her with 12V149's in the Mid 70's after the engines locked up going into the chamber at Gallipolis. Had rudders as big as barn doors. Beat the Claire Beatty in a shove off @ regatta.
